Harlandale Methodist Church - Food Distribution Center
Who Can Visit?
This food distribution is open to everyone in the community. No preregistration is required, so you can show up on any distribution day and receive help.
Good to Know
Distribution ends promptly at noon, so plan to arrive with enough time. Make sure to bring your own box, bags, or cart to carry your food home.
How to Pick Up
When you arrive, volunteers will greet you, sign you in, and hand out food directly. Visitors describe the experience as fast and welcoming, with church members on hand to help.
